Initial approval for 35-day annual leave in private sector

Thursday, March 7, 2019

The National Assembly on Wednesday overwhelmingly approved in the first reading a key amendment to the labor law in the private sector to increase annual leave from 30 to 35 days.

All 45 MPs present voted for the amendment, which will become final when the Assembly holds the second and final voting on the law. The government did not object but refused to make it retroactive from 2010, saying it is not possible to apply the law in this fashion.

The law applies to both Kuwaitis and expatriates working in the private sector.

The last time the annual leave was increased was in 2010.
